In Rococo style, lines were less massive, the curves were more slender and delicate, and an emphasis on asymmetrical balance gained importance. It is characterized by elaborate ornamentation, asymmetrical values, pastel color palette, and curved or serpentine lines.

For example, Rococo style can be seen in the sculptures, furniture, room décor, and paintings of the time, where delicate curves formed shapes on walls and ceilings, and pastel colors reflected light. The Rococo style developed first in the decorative arts and later spread to architecture, sculpture, theater design, painting, and music.
